(4) A recipe calls for 5 cups of flour for every 2 cups of sugar. If | want to make the recipe using 8 cups of flour, how much sugar should | use? (5) Suppose a 30 mg dose of a particular medication is recommended for a dog that weighs 95 Ibs. How many mg of this medication should be given to a dog weighing 18 Ibs.? (6) Cefaclor is a medication used for infections. It is often given in liquid form. A pharmacist is mixing a prescription for a child. The instructions indicate that 145 mg of Cefaclor should be mixed with 5 ml of fluid. If the child only requires a dosage of 100 mg of Cefaclor, how much fluid should be in each dosage?
